In this subtractive drawing, I was originally planning to only draw the ribcage (the middle sheet). I wanted to practice a "freer" and messier style of drawing, so I made a charcoal layer and then used my eraser to take way parts until a ribcage formed, referencing a skeletal model. I added the top and bottom sheets to create a more complete image of the skeleton, allowing myself the freedom to explore this new technique.
